About

Integrated Retirement Investment Solutions, LLC, doing business as T.I.P.S. 4 Reps, provides retirement plan advisory, investment management and non-securities consulting and professional succession planning to individuals, high-net-worth clients, businesses and company retirement plans. The firm offers plan-level services such as 401(k) platform and vendor reviews, pooled pension and non‑qualified plan oversight, as well as portfolio management and participant allocation recommendations on an individualized basis.

The firm’s investment work relies heavily on identifying, recommending and monitoring unaffiliated Independent Managers and model allocations, with a notable emphasis on non‑discretionary engagements and advice rather than routine discretionary trading. IRIS conducts initial and ongoing due diligence on recommended managers, may facilitate participant‑level allocation guidance on request, and provides periodic reviews to align manager performance with client objectives.

Distinctive features disclosed in the brochure include a small advisor team supporting a limited client base while reporting substantially more assets under advisement than assets under management, and an unusually high share of non‑discretionary AUM and advisory relationships. The firm also discloses referral and revenue‑sharing arrangements with Independent Managers and Professional Partners, insurance agency activity, and affiliations with non‑investment entities (including donor facilitation and business/tax planning ventures), which the brochure identifies as material conflicts of interest that are disclosed to clients.

Fee options

Fixed

Fixed fees for general consulting and professional succession planning services typically range from $10,000 to $15,000, negotiable.

Percentage

$0+: 0.20% to 1.50% annually (negotiable) +: Up to 2.00% annually total combined fee including Independent Manager fees

Commissions

Insurance commissions earned by Mr. Vrablic as an independent insurance professional; separate and in addition to advisory fees.

Project-based

Hourly consulting fees for general consulting and professional succession planning services ranging from $350 to $500 per hour.

Other

Fee-only: Investment advisory fees ranging from 0.20% to 1.50% annually, negotiable; financial planning services generally provided at no additional cost under Professional Partnership engagements; general consulting and professional succession planning fixed fees typically range from $10,000 to $15,000 or hourly rates of $350 to $500.
